Transaction 1550c3c807181fa3060d1162cc6ff2c8313fe5777277de52ba9bf97f5291a8b9

2 Input
1 Outputs
  • 1550c3c807181fa3060d1162cc6ff2c8313fe5777277de52ba9bf97f5291a8b9:0
  • value  125153
    address  3KmsUpoYNH2g9RZCbhSJmo3yFYNPZo1VUQ